From: "Andriy Dobrovol's'kii" <dobr@iop.kiev.ua> To: Sisyphus <sisyphus@altlinux.ru> Subject: [sisyphus] rpm & spec Date: Tue, 26 Oct 2004 13:05:01 +0300 Message-ID: <417E214D.9000408@iop.kiev.ua> (raw) Hi, Пробую собрать себе програмку в виде рпм пакета. Всё бы ничего, но у нас сборка должна выполняться от имени обычного пользователя. Из-за этого она тупо обламывается при переходе к %install. Ес-но не хватает прав на запись в системные каталоги. Сама сборка и установка с административными правами из тарбола проходит на ура и дает рабочую программу. Мне уже сказали, что засада в значении $RPM_BUILD_ROOT, но не могу понять в чем именно. На этапе входа в %install она определена как + echo /home/andriy/RPM/tmp/sarg-buildroot /home/andriy/RPM/tmp/sarg-buildroot + exit 0 И сборка исходников проходит нормально. Что видно из лога. А дальше всё обламывается на line 88: /home/andriy/RPM/tmp/sarg-buildroot: No such file or directory. Так как её создать? И почему она не создается без дополнительных телодвижений? Executing(%install): /bin/sh -e /home/andriy/RPM/tmp/rpm-tmp.72995 + umask 022 + /bin/mkdir -p /home/andriy/RPM/BUILD + cd /home/andriy/RPM/BUILD + /bin/chmod -Rf u+rwX -- /home/andriy/RPM/tmp/sarg-buildroot + : + /bin/rm -rf -- /home/andriy/RPM/tmp/sarg-buildroot Вернее даже, почему она здесь удаляется?? И уже не создается... + cd sarg-2.0.1 + echo /home/andriy/RPM/tmp/sarg-buildroot /home/andriy/RPM/tmp/sarg-buildroot + /home/andriy/RPM/tmp/sarg-buildroot /home/andriy/RPM/sarg-buildroot /home/andriy/RPM/tmp/rpm-tmp.72995: line 88: /home/andriy/RPM/tmp/sarg-buildroot: No such file or directory error: Bad exit status from /home/andriy/RPM/tmp/rpm-tmp.72995 (%install) Куда должна указывать эта переменная для нормальной сборки? И где её таки нужно определять? -- Rgrds, Andriy ********************************************************************* email: dobr at iop dot kiev dot ua Kyiv, Ukraine Phone: (380-44) 265-7824 Department of Gas Electronics Fax: (380-44) 265-2329 Institute of Physics of NASU *********************************************************************
next reply other threads:[~2004-10-26 10:05 UTC|newest] Thread overview: 86+ messages / expand[flat|nested] mbox.gz Atom feed top 2004-10-26 10:05 Andriy Dobrovol's'kii [this message] 2004-10-26 10:02 ` Genix 2004-10-26 10:25 ` scor 2004-10-26 10:34 ` Mike Lykov 2004-10-26 11:17 ` scor 2004-10-26 14:35 ` [sisyphus][JT] " Andrey Rahmatullin 2004-10-26 17:41 ` scor 2004-10-27 7:30 ` iLL 2004-10-27 13:27 ` Andrey Rahmatullin 2004-10-27 14:42 ` scor 2004-10-30 10:35 ` Денис Смирнов 2004-10-26 13:16 ` [sisyphus] " Andriy Dobrovol's'kii 2004-10-26 13:14 ` Genix 2004-10-26 14:23 ` Andriy Dobrovol's'kii 2004-10-26 14:21 ` Epiphanov Sergei 2004-10-26 14:48 ` Andriy Dobrovol's'kii 2004-10-26 15:18 ` Epiphanov Sergei 2004-10-26 17:53 ` Vladimir Lettiev 2004-10-27 4:55 ` [sisyphus] подсчет траффика squid Mike Lykov 2004-10-27 5:33 ` Vladimir Lettiev 2004-10-27 6:20 ` Mike Lykov 2004-10-27 6:53 ` Epiphanov Sergei 2004-10-27 6:57 ` Vladimir Lettiev 2004-10-27 6:47 ` [sisyphus] rpm & spec Epiphanov Sergei 2004-10-27 6:59 ` [sisyphus] подсчет траффика squid Mike Lykov 2004-10-27 7:38 ` [sisyphus] подсчет трафика squid Epiphanov Sergei 2004-10-27 7:37 ` Mike Lykov 2004-10-27 6:41 ` [sisyphus] rpm & spec Epiphanov Sergei 2004-10-27 6:54 ` Epiphanov Sergei 2004-10-26 14:58 ` [sisyphus] " Michael Shigorin 2004-10-26 15:11 ` Michael Shigorin 2004-10-26 16:13 ` Andriy Dobrovol's'kii 2004-10-26 16:35 ` Michael Shigorin 2004-10-27 10:10 ` Andriy Dobrovol's'kii 2004-10-27 6:05 ` [sisyphus] " Genix 2004-10-27 6:23 ` Mike Lykov 2004-10-26 10:32 ` Sergey 2004-10-26 10:32 ` Alexey Gladkov 2004-10-26 11:46 ` Andriy Dobrovol's'kii 2004-10-26 11:28 ` Ivan Fedorov 2004-10-26 14:34 ` Andrey Rahmatullin 2004-10-27 8:05 ` Ivan Fedorov 2004-10-26 12:21 ` Alexey Gladkov 2004-10-26 13:37 ` Andriy Dobrovol's'kii 2004-10-26 13:32 ` Sergey 2004-10-26 13:36 ` Alexey Gladkov 2004-10-26 14:28 ` Andriy Dobrovol's'kii 2004-10-26 14:24 ` Alexey Gladkov 2004-11-03 11:30 ` Andriy Dobrovol's'kii 2004-11-03 10:21 ` Alexey Gladkov 2004-11-03 16:32 ` Andriy Dobrovol's'kii 2004-11-03 15:19 ` Alexey Gladkov 2004-11-03 16:52 ` Andriy Dobrovol's'kii 2004-11-03 15:48 ` Alexey Gladkov 2004-10-26 14:41 ` Andrey Rahmatullin 2004-10-26 16:23 ` Andriy Dobrovol's'kii 2004-10-27 8:11 ` Ivan Fedorov 2004-10-27 9:35 ` [sisyphus] " Michael Shigorin 2004-10-27 12:51 ` Andriy Dobrovol's'kii 2004-10-27 13:42 ` Michael Shigorin 2004-10-27 14:25 ` Andriy Dobrovol's'kii 2004-10-27 14:19 ` Andrey Rahmatullin 2004-10-27 15:42 ` Andriy Dobrovol's'kii 2004-10-27 15:26 ` Michael Shigorin 2004-10-28 13:32 ` Andriy Dobrovol's'kii 2004-10-28 13:21 ` Genix 2004-10-28 16:37 ` Andriy Dobrovol's'kii 2004-10-28 16:40 ` Andrey Rahmatullin 2004-10-29 10:31 ` Andriy Dobrovol's'kii 2004-10-29 13:15 ` Andrey Rahmatullin 2004-10-29 14:18 ` Andriy Dobrovol's'kii 2004-10-29 15:30 ` Andrey Rahmatullin 2004-10-29 8:05 ` Evgeniy Kobzev 2004-10-29 8:14 ` Ivan Fedorov 2004-10-29 9:12 ` Andrey Rahmatullin 2004-10-28 15:13 ` Michael Shigorin 2004-10-27 14:31 ` Sergey Bolshakov 2004-10-27 15:01 ` Andriy Dobrovol's'kii 2004-10-27 14:45 ` Michael Shigorin 2004-10-27 14:46 ` Sergey Bolshakov 2004-10-27 15:23 ` Andriy Dobrovol's'kii 2004-10-27 15:12 ` Michael Shigorin 2004-10-27 15:17 ` Pyatnitskich Evgeniy 2004-10-27 15:49 ` Andriy Dobrovol's'kii 2004-10-27 16:17 ` Andrey Rahmatullin 2004-10-27 13:47 ` Andrey Rahmatullin
Reply instructions: You may reply publicly to this message via plain-text email using any one of the following methods: * Save the following mbox file, import it into your mail client, and reply-to-all from there: mbox Avoid top-posting and favor interleaved quoting: https://en.wikipedia.org/wiki/Posting_style#Interleaved_style * Reply using the --to, --cc, and --in-reply-to switches of git-send-email(1): git send-email \ --in-reply-to=417E214D.9000408@iop.kiev.ua \ --to=dobr@iop.kiev.ua \ --cc=sisyphus@altlinux.ru \ /path/to/YOUR_REPLY https://kernel.org/pub/software/scm/git/docs/git-send-email.html * If your mail client supports setting the In-Reply-To header via mailto: links, try the mailto: link
ALT Linux Sisyphus discussions This inbox may be cloned and mirrored by anyone: git clone --mirror http://lore.altlinux.org/sisyphus/0 sisyphus/git/0.git # If you have public-inbox 1.1+ installed, you may # initialize and index your mirror using the following commands: public-inbox-init -V2 sisyphus sisyphus/ http://lore.altlinux.org/sisyphus \ sisyphus@altlinux.ru sisyphus@altlinux.org sisyphus@lists.altlinux.org sisyphus@lists.altlinux.ru sisyphus@lists.altlinux.com sisyphus@linuxteam.iplabs.ru sisyphus@list.linux-os.ru public-inbox-index sisyphus Example config snippet for mirrors. Newsgroup available over NNTP: nntp://lore.altlinux.org/org.altlinux.lists.sisyphus AGPL code for this site: git clone https://public-inbox.org/public-inbox.git